How they compare
Solomon Islands currently reports 0 against 0 in Saint Vincent and the Grenadines, a difference of 0.
The two have swapped places 8 times across 31 shared years of data; in 1986 it was Saint Vincent and the Grenadines ahead.
Solomon Islands ranks 63rd and Saint Vincent and the Grenadines ranks 63rd of 205 countries.
Solomon Islands has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Solomon Islands | Saint Vincent and the Grenadines |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 4.72 | 0 | 4.72 | Solomon Islands |
| 1990s | 4.99 | 0.99 | 4 | Solomon Islands |
| 2000s | 0.6856 | 0 | 0.6856 | Solomon Islands |
| 2010s | 0 | 0 | 0 | — |
| 2020s | 0 | 0 | 0 | — |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
